3 Key Benefits to Web Log Analysis

Whether it’s Apache, Nginx, ILS, or anything else, web servers are at the core of online services, and web log analysis can reveal a treasure trove of information. These logs may be hidden away in many files on disk, split by HTTP status code, timestamp, or agent, among other possibilities. Web access logs are typically analyzed to troubleshoot operational issues, but there is so much more insight that you can draw from this data, from SEO to user experience.

Lockless code deploys in Puppet Enterprise & Continuous Delivery for PE

Your Puppet Enterprise (PE) installation’s primary job is to compile catalogs and send them to agents to be enforced. When you deploy code, all catalog compilation stops and waits for the code deploy to complete. This impacts performance in any installation, and the impact escalates with more frequent code deployments. Code deployments usually increase when you use Continuous Delivery for Puppet Enterprise, making the impacts of stopped catalog compilations even more apparent.
